Arduino Employed Power Theft Controller and IoTbased Load Controlling for Smart Energy Meter System

Project Code :TEMBMA3410

Objective

The main objective of this project is to measure currents at load using Energy meter and if it increases threshold current then we say that power theft occured

Abstract

This project deals with proper monitoring and controlling of energy consumption as well as detecting the power theft if anyone is trying to theft the electricity. Nowadays, lots of energy gets wasted due to thefts and consumer has to wait for the person to come from utility to provide them with the energy meter bill. An Internet of Things (IoT) and Arduino-based smart energy meter is suggested as a solution to these issues. The Arduino uno used in this project is controlling the power theft if anyone tries to theft electricity. With the implementation of IoT, which is required Node MCU i.e., not only controlling the loads which are connected to a relay but also providing the details of energy consumption to IoT interface so that information can be used by the consumer.
